Snub: “Wicked: For Good” Shut Out
In a surprise turn after recognizing “Wicked” in 10 nominations across the board at the 2025 honors, the Academy thoroughly rejected its sequel, ”Wicked: For Good.” It was an expected contender in Best Song and Best Supporting Actress for Ariana Grande.
